Consider, for instance, the way a single amino acid substitution in a protein can shift its folding kinetics, exposing a hydrophobic core that was previously buried, thereby changing its interaction surface and potentially triggering a cascade of downstream effects that ripple through cellular signaling pathways. In genetic terms, these variants are not mere typos in the text of life; they are experimental edits, some of which have been tested across millions of years of evolutionary pressure, while others are novel mutations arising in a single individual, carrying the weight of potential disease or adaptation. The distinction between a synonymous and a non-synonymous variant is not just a matter of nucleotide identity but of functional consequence: the former might leave the protein sequence untouched, yet even then, changes in codon usage can affect translation speed, co-translational folding, and mRNA stability, creating phenotypic variation without altering the final amino acid chain. In the realm of human genomics, variants are cataloged with increasing precision, from single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) to large structural rearrangements like copy number variations, each class presenting its own challenges for annotation and clinical interpretation. A variant in a non-coding region, such as a promoter or enhancer, might alter transcription factor binding affinity by a factor of two, pushing the expression level of a gene past a threshold that determines whether a cell commits to a particular fate during development. Similarly, variants in splice sites can lead to exon skipping or intron retention, producing isoforms that are either degraded by nonsense-mediated decay or translated into proteins with dominant-negative effects. The concept of variant effect prediction is built upon the idea that we can infer functional impact from sequence context, but the reality is far more complex: the same variant might be benign in one genetic background and pathogenic in another, due to epistatic interactions that are only now being mapped through large-scale association studies. Population genetics offers a framework to classify variants by allele frequency and selection coefficient, yet these parameters are themselves dynamic, shifting with environmental changes, population bottlenecks, and admixture events. In clinical diagnostics, a variant of uncertain significance (VUS) is a common outcome of genetic testing, leaving patients and clinicians in a state of uncertainty that underscores our incomplete understanding of the genome’s regulatory grammar. The rise of long-read sequencing has revealed that many variants are not just single base changes but complex haplotypes with multiple co-inherited alterations, complicating the notion of a ‘reference’ genome and highlighting the need for pangenomic representations. Furthermore, epigenetic variants—such as differential methylation patterns or histone modification states—are heritable yet reversible, adding another layer of variability that is not captured by DNA sequence alone. In cancer genomics, variants accumulate clonally, and the heterogeneity within a tumor means that a single biopsy might sample only a fraction of the mutational landscape, leading to challenges in targeted therapy selection. The field of pharmacogenomics leverages known variants in drug-metabolizing enzymes to predict adverse reactions or efficacy, but even here, rare variants with large effects coexist with common variants of small effect, and the clinical utility depends on the availability of comprehensive variant databases and decision support tools. Beyond humans, in agricultural breeding, variants are selected for desirable traits such as yield or drought resistance, but the process is constrained by linkage drag and the trade-offs between traits. In evolutionary biology, the study of variants across species reveals signatures of positive selection, where a beneficial allele rises to fixation, or balancing selection, where multiple variants are maintained due to heterozygote advantage or frequency-dependent selection. The statistical methods to detect such variants rely on models of demography and mutation, and they are continually refined as more genomes are sequenced. In the context of gene therapy, the precise introduction of a corrective variant using CRISPR-based tools requires not only efficient delivery but also careful consideration of off-target effects and the potential for unintended variants at other loci. The ethical implications of germline variant editing are profound, as changes would be inherited by future generations, and the debate hinges on our ability to predict long-term consequences. Moreover, the interpretation of variants is inherently probabilistic: a variant that increases risk for a complex disease by 10% is not deterministic, and the actual outcome depends on a web of environmental exposures, lifestyle factors, and stochastic developmental events.

O que é um casino ao vivo?
Um casino ao vivo é uma plataforma de jogo online que transmite jogos de mesa em tempo real, com dealers profissionais, através de streaming de vídeo. Os jogadores podem interagir com o dealer e outros participantes, proporcionando uma experiência autêntica de casino físico a partir de casa.
Como funcionam os jogos de casino ao vivo?
Os jogos são transmitidos a partir de estúdios especializados ou de casinos reais, utilizando câmaras de alta definição e tecnologia de streaming. O dealer realiza as ações reais (como cartas ou roleta) e os jogadores fazem as suas apostas através de uma interface digital, com resultados determinados por equipamentos físicos ou software certificado.
Quais são os limites de aposta típicos?
Os limites de aposta variam consoante o jogo e a mesa, mas geralmente encontram-se valores acessíveis para todos os orçamentos. Algumas mesas têm limites baixos (por exemplo, €6 ou menos), enquanto outras podem aceitar apostas elevadas para high rollers. É importante verificar as informações de cada mesa antes de começar.
Posso jogar em casino ao vivo no meu telemóvel?
Sim, a maioria dos casinos ao vivo é totalmente compatível com dispositivos móveis, incluindo smartphones e tablets. Através de browsers modernos ou aplicações dedicadas, pode aceder aos jogos com a mesma qualidade de streaming e funcionalidades, bastando ter uma ligação à internet estável.
Que tipos de jogos estão disponíveis?
Os jogos mais comuns incluem blackjack, roleta, bacará e póquer, com variações como roleta europeia ou americana, blackjack com side bets e mesas de bacará em direto. Também existem jogos inovadores, como shows de jogos e programas de entretenimento, todos transmitidos por dealers profissionais.
A experiência é justa e segura?
Sim, os jogos de casino ao vivo utilizam equipamentos físicos reais e são supervisionados por reguladores, garantindo a aleatoriedade dos resultados. Além disso, as transmissões são encriptadas e as plataformas operam sob licenças de jogo reconhecidas (SRIJ — Serviço de Regulação e Inspeção de Jogos), assegurando um ambiente seguro e transparente para os jogadores.

O jogo é destinado apenas a maiores de 18 anos e deve ser encarado como uma forma de entretenimento, nunca como uma fonte de rendimento. Em Portugal, a atividade é regulada pelo Serviço de Regulação e Inspeção de Jogos (SRIJ), que também disponibiliza o mecanismo de autoexclusão, permitindo-lhe bloquear o acesso a plataformas de jogo online. Se sentir que o jogo está a afetar a sua vida, procure ajuda junto do Jogo Responsável (SRIJ), que oferece apoio e orientação. Defina sempre limites de tempo e de depósito antes de começar e nunca tente recuperar perdas, pois isso pode levar a comportamentos de risco. Jogue com moderação e responsabilidade.
